appointment.wxml 4.0 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071727374757677787980818283848586
  1. <!--pages/appointment/appointment.wxml-->
  2. <view class="appointment">
  3. <view class="main-con">
  4. <view class="account">
  5. <view class="ac-title sub-title">账户信息</view>
  6. <view class="ac-card ittflex-jcs">
  7. <view class="ac-left ac-item ittflex-jcs">
  8. <view class="ac-avat"></view>
  9. <view class="ac-name">测试用户</view>
  10. </view>
  11. <view class="ac-right ac-item ittflex-jcs">
  12. <text class="ac-count">100</text>
  13. <text class="ac-unit">次</text>
  14. </view>
  15. </view>
  16. </view>
  17. <view class="address">
  18. <view class="ad-title sub-title">上门检测地址</view>
  19. <view wx:if="{{!hasAddress}}" class="no-address chose-address ittflex" bindtap="handleChoseAddress">选择上门服务地址</view>
  20. <view wx:else class="address-card ittflex-jcs">
  21. <view class="ad-left">
  22. <view class="ad-top ittflex-jcs">
  23. <text class="ad-name">{{contactName}}</text>
  24. <text class="ad-phone">{{contactPhone}}</text>
  25. </view>
  26. <view class="ad-bottom address-detail">
  27. {{address}}
  28. </view>
  29. </view>
  30. <view class="ad-right ittflex">
  31. <view class="chose-address-btn {{appointmentSuccess ? 'itt-btn-disabled' : 'itt-btn'}}" bindtap="handleChangeAddress">更换地址</view>
  32. </view>
  33. </view>
  34. <view class="ad-tips">注:预约成功后,检测地址不允许更改</view>
  35. </view>
  36. <view class="calendar-wy">
  37. <view class="sub-title ca-title">预约上门服务时间</view>
  38. <view class="calendar-card">
  39. <view class="calendar-card-header">
  40. <view class="curr-date">
  41. <text>{{curYear}}年{{curMonth}}月</text>
  42. </view>
  43. <view class="cal-tips ittflex">
  44. <view class="warn-icon"></view>
  45. <text class="warn-text">代表繁忙时间</text>
  46. </view>
  47. </view>
  48. <view class="calendar-card-body">
  49. <view class="week-header ittflex-jcs">
  50. <view class="week-item">日</view>
  51. <view class="week-item">一</view>
  52. <view class="week-item">二</view>
  53. <view class="week-item">三</view>
  54. <view class="week-item">四</view>
  55. <view class="week-item">五</view>
  56. <view class="week-item">六</view>
  57. </view>
  58. <view class="week-body">
  59. <view class="week-body-item backup-week-body-item {{item.disabled ? 'week-body-item-disabled' : ''}} {{item.date == '约满' ? 'week-body-item-full' : ''}}" wx:for="{{backupWeekList}}" wx:key="index">
  60. <view class="date">{{item.date}}</view>
  61. </view>
  62. <view class="week-body-item {{item.disabled ? 'week-body-item-disabled' : ''}} {{item.active ? 'week-body-item-active' : ''}} {{item.date == '约满' ? 'week-body-item-full' : ''}}" wx:for="{{weekList}}" wx:key="index">
  63. <view class="date" data-date="{{item.dateStr}}" data-disabled="{{item.disabled}}" data-index="{{index}}" bindtap="handleSelectDate">{{item.date}}</view>
  64. </view>
  65. </view>
  66. </view>
  67. </view>
  68. <view class="time-list ittflex">
  69. <view class="time-a time-item time-nurse {{timeActive == '1' ? 'time-active' : ''}}" data-time="1" bindtap="handleTime">
  70. <text class="t-text">8:00-12:00</text>
  71. <!-- <text class="time-nurse-text">剩余紧张</text> -->
  72. </view>
  73. <view class="time-b time-item {{timeActive == '2' ? 'time-active' : ''}}" data-time="2" bindtap="handleTime">
  74. <text class="t-text">13:00-18:00</text>
  75. </view>
  76. <view class="time-c time-item {{timeActive == '3' ? 'time-active' : ''}}" data-time="3" bindtap="handleTime">
  77. <text class="t-text">18:00-21:00</text>
  78. </view>
  79. </view>
  80. </view>
  81. <view class="footer-actions ittflex-jcb">
  82. <view class="f-btn cancel-btn ittflex" bindtap="handleCancel">取消</view>
  83. <view class="f-btn confirm-btn itt-btn" bindtap="handleConfirm">确定</view>
  84. </view>
  85. </view>
  86. </view>